GATE 2018: Detailed Information


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ering (GATE) is an examination on the comprehensive understanding of the candidates in various undergraduate subjects in Engineering/Technology/Architecture and post-graduate level subjects in Science.

GATE is administered jointly by the Indian Institute of Science (IISc), Bangalore and seven Indian Institutes of Technology (namely, IITs at Bombay, Delhi, Guwahati, Kanpur,Kharagpur, Madras and Roorkee).

As per the official website, this is the detailed information about GATE 2018:

  • IIT Guwahati is the organising institute for GATE 2018
  • The GATE 2018 exam date is on February 3, February 4, February 10, and February 11
  • GATE 2018 will be held on 23 subjects (also referred to as "papers")
  • Examination for all the 23 subjects (papers) will be Computer Based Test (CBT)
  • A candidate can appear only in any one paper of the GATE examination
  • Some papers in GATE 2018 would be held in multiple sessions. Though, a candidate can appear for the examination in one session only
  • The GATE 2018 admit card would be available only on GOAPS website. Candidates can download their GATE 2018 admit card from the official website. Candidates must note that no printed copy of the admit cards will be sent to the candidates.
  • The GATE score 2018 would reflect the relative performance level of the candidate in a particular subject, which is quantified based on the several years of examination data. The score is valid for three years from the date of announcement of the results.
